“Philippine Hat, ca. 1900” is an item in the Mapping Philippine Material Culture collection. Mapping Philippine Material Culture is a digital humanities project in London, UK that aims to visually inventory Philippine material culture in overseas collections from around 1500–1950. 

The traditional Philippine hat, called the salakot, is a wide-brimmed hat made from local materials like bamboo, palms, and rattan leaves.
